区块链项目的代码质量对安全性有着至关重要的影响,但并不是唯一决定因素。在探讨这个问题时,我们可以从多个角度来分析。
首先,代码质量确实是安全性的基石。高质量的代码意味着开发者遵循了良好的编程实践,减少了潜在漏洞的存在。例如,在智能合约中,哪怕是微小的逻辑错误也可能导致资金被盗或被恶意利用。2016年The DAO事件就是一个典型案例,由于代码中的一个小小疏忽,黑客得以转移了数百万美元的以太坊。因此,严格的代码审计、测试以及遵循最佳实践是确保项目安全的重要步骤。
其次,除了代码本身的质量外,安全还依赖于整个系统的架构设计和运营维护。即使代码编写得再好,如果部署环境存在安全隐患(如服务器配置不当),或者缺乏有效的监控和应急响应机制,那么项目仍然可能面临风险。此外,外部攻击手段也在不断进化,新的威胁可能会绕过现有防护措施,这就要求团队持续关注最新的安全动态并及时更新系统。
最后,社区的支持与反馈也是保障项目安全的关键要素之一。一个活跃且专业的开发者社区能够快速发现并修复问题,同时分享经验教训,共同提高整个生态系统的安全性。相比之下,那些封闭、缺乏透明度的项目则更容易出现问题却难以得到及时解决。
综上所述,虽然代码质量对于区块链项目的安全性至关重要,但它只是众多影响因素中的一个方面。真正的安全需要从开发到运维再到社区治理等多维度共同努力才能实现。投资者在评估一个区块链项目时,不仅要关注其技术实现层面的表现,还要综合考量其他非技术性因素,这样才能更全面地判断其长期发展潜力和风险水平。
发布于2025-01-03 12:47 吉隆坡
![](/licai/Home/image/ask/ybz-icon.png)
![](/licai/Home/image/ask/oppose-r.png)
![](/licai/Home/image/ask/zhuiwen1-icon.png)
![](/licai/Home/image/ask/gd-down.png)
![](/licai/Home/image/ask/cai-icon.png)
![](/licai/Home/image/ask/jb1-icon.png)